Здравейте отново и ви благодаря предварително за помощта.
Проверих няколко предишни въпроса и не можах да намеря точно тази ситуация.
Опитвам се да транспонирам/завъртя ред към колона, но резултатите се основават на функция за дата в клаузата where, което прави избора ми донякъде променлив.
SELECT DATE_FORMAT(packet_details.installDate,'%m-%d-%Y') as Install_Date, Count(packet_details.installDate) FROM packet_details WHERE packet_details.installDate >= CURRENT_DATE - INTERVAL 7 DAY AND packet_details.installDate "*lessthan*" CURRENT_DATE + INTERVAL 7 DAY GROUP BY installDate *lessthan symbol wont show here on Stack & i don't know how to fix it
Не съм сигурен дали има смисъл, затова включих цигулка: http://sqlfiddle.com/#!2/5b235/3/0 Така че нещо подобно:
INSTALL_DATE COUNT 1/24/2013 2 1/25/2013 2 1/26/2013 2 1/27/2013 2 1/28/2013 2 1/29/2013 1 2/3/2013 1 2/4/2013 1 2/5/2013 5 2/6/2013 4
Се превърна в:
INSTALL_DATE 1/24/2013 1/25/2013 1/26/2013 1/27/2013 1/28/2013.... COUNT 2 2 2 2 2 1